Update libp2p (#2101)
This is a little bit of a tip-of-the-iceberg PR. It houses a lot of code changes in the libp2p dependency. This needs a bit of thorough testing before merging. The primary code changes are: - General libp2p dependency update - Gossipsub refactor to shift compression into gossipsub providing performance improvements and improved API for handling compression Co-authored-by: Paul Hauner <paul@paulhauner.com>
